1. USSD Integration

Unstructured Supplementary Service Data (USSD) is a technology that allows information to be sent between a mobile phone and an application program in the network. It is widely used for interactive services, such as mobile banking, balance inquiries, and mobile subscriptions.

Instant Accessibility


USSD provides instant access to services without requiring an internet connection. This makes it a valuable tool for businesses reaching out to customers in areas with limited internet access.

Secure Transactions

Integration with USSD ensures secure and efficient transactions, making it an ideal solution for mobile banking, bill payments, and other financial services.

Interactive Customer Engagement


USSD menus enable interactive communication with users, allowing businesses to gather feedback, conduct surveys, and provide personalized services.

2. SMS Integration


Short Message Service (SMS) remains one of the most ubiquitous forms of communication globally. Integrating SMS into business processes enhances communication reliability and reach

Instant Notifications


SMS integration is crucial for sending instant notifications, such as order confirmations, appointment reminders, and delivery updates, ensuring timely information to customers.

Two-Factor Authentication (2FA)


SMS is commonly used for secure two-factor authentication, adding an extra layer of security to online transactions and user accounts.

Marketing and Promotions:


Businesses leverage SMS for marketing campaigns, promotions, and announcements, capitalizing on the direct and personal nature of text messages.
3. WhatsApp Integration:

WhatsApp, with its extensive user base, has become a prominent platform for business communication. Integrating WhatsApp into business processes enables rich media interactions and real-time customer engagement.
Multimedia Communication

WhatsApp integration allows businesses to send not only text but also multimedia content such as images, videos, and documents, enhancing the richness of communication.
Business Automation

Automation tools integrated with WhatsApp enable businesses to automate routine tasks, send order updates, and provide personalized experiences at scale.
